The regular production procedure changes raw products such as silica sand, lime, concrete, gypsum, and water into AAC blocks or panels via a series of steps including mixing, casting, curing, and cutting. One of the essential components of an effective AAC production line is making use of innovative equipment, which ranges from the mixing equipment to the autoclaving systems that give the necessary high-pressure vapor treating to strengthen the finished item.

A complete AAC panel and block assembly line usually makes up different makers that add to the overall functionality and efficiency of the center. Initially, there are the raw product preparation systems, that include storage aggregates, crushers, and blending terminals. Following that, check here the spreading and cutting equipment plays an important role in forming the damp mix right into mold and mildews that will certainly heal right into blocks or panels. Autoclaves are important in this procedure, supplying the essential setting for high-pressure and high-temperature treating to achieve the last preferred characteristics of the AAC items. Once the blocks are all set, they are handled and loaded for shipment, completing the production cycle. Suppliers likewise integrate automation technology to boost efficiency and minimize labor costs, enabling better accuracy and consistency in item quality.
